First in a series called “Thrall”.

The Thrall concept is yet another variation of the “vampire” theme. Instead of being infected by a “virus” the Thrall is a parasite which takes over the body and mind of its host for a few years. Eventually the body wears down and a new host is selected to receive the next queens eggs. Additionally the Thrall lives in a hive culture with a single reproductive queen leader and her drones the “hosts”. Humans all considered the “Prey” that feeds the hive the blood they need. Humans can also be Herd if they voluntarily feed the Hosts.

Montana Creeds: Dylan – Linda Lael Miller

  • Posted on April 11, 2009 at 10:43 am
Number 2 in the trilogy of the modern day Creed Clan. Three brothers Logan, Dylan and Tyler grew up under an alcoholic father and a long line of step moms. They were united as youths but had a major fight after their father was killed in an accident. They have long since gone their separate ways.

Dylan is the middle brother. He is a rodeo star and poker player, enjoying his life even though he is estranged from his two brothers. One night after a poker game he finds his two year old daughter in his truck, abandoned by her mother. Forced to become a responsible dad, he takes Bonnie to his home town of Stillwater Springs to raise her.

Death Angel – Linda Howard

  • Posted on July 22, 2008 at 1:33 pm
Would you live your life differently if you were given a second chance. Linda Howard tackles these issues in an unconventional romance.

I was able to snag this story on audiobook. I love and hate that. It is nice to listen to a story when you are going about mindless activity, but then I found myself looking for mindless time when I shouldn’t.

The heroine, Drea, is a drug lords mistress who is not the dim bulb she pretends to be. She has vowed to get the most out of life. She has no problem in being a mans play toy as long as it gets her money, the finest clothing and jewels. Her existence is very shallow and she makes no apologies for this.
